What side of the road do they drive on in Candelo?
You’ll be motoring along the right-hand side of the road in Candelo. Even though it may seem similar to home, it’s always smart to drive with extra care in new and unfamiliar destinations.

Are there speed limits in Candelo?
While navigating through the streets of Candelo, keep in mind that the speed limits usually range from 50km/h to 130km/h. Residential areas are 50km/h unless posted otherwise.
What happens if I get a speeding fine while driving a rental car in Piedmont?
One of two things will happen. Your car rental company may bill the fined amount to your credit card. This is the most common approach. On the other hand, it may provide your contact details to the relevant local agency so the fine is issued directly to you.
Is it illegal to use a cell phone while driving in Candelo?
As with many places, standard cell phone usage is prohibited while driving in Candelo. However, there is an exception for hands-free or Bluetooth capabilities. Just remember to stay focused on the road.
What are the rules around drink driving in Candelo?
In Candelo, it’s a fineable offence to drive with a BAC (blood alcohol content) in excess of 0.05%. If you’re going to have a few drinks over dinner, it’s a good idea to leave your car behind.
Is turning on a red light allowed in Candelo?
No. In Candelo, red means stop, with no exceptions. When approaching traffic lights, always drive at a safe speed so you can easily stop if you need to.
Are seat belts compulsory in Piedmont?
Seat belts have to be worn in Piedmont. However, the rule may not apply for some vehicles, such as those used by public transportation networks.
